Job Description

Te kaupapa o te tūranga - The purpose of the role. 

NOTE THIS IS A CASUAL ROLE WITH NO SET SHIFTS.

We're seeking a vigilant and proactive Loss Prevention Officer to join our team. Your main focus will be preventing theft and ensuring the safety of our staff and customers. 

Key Responsibilities: 

  • Monitor security cameras 
  • Maintain a visible presence on the shop-floor 
  • Interact with customers and address their concerns
  • Upload events onto our crime reporting platform.  

This is a Casual Position

Qualifications

He kōrero mōu ake - About you

Experience in a customer-facing role, such as retail or hospitality, would be beneficial but is not required. Ideally, you will have good communication skills and a positive attitude, along with a willingness to learn. You should be comfortable standing for extended periods.

Additionally, experience in conflict resolution and de-escalation, along with the ability to stay calm under pressure, would be beneficial.
